Directions


  1. Lay the onion chunks and parsnips in the bottom of a greased slow cooker.

  2. Sprinkle some salt and pepper all over the brisket.

  3. Get a small mixing bowl: mix in it the coriander, cumin, cinnamon, garlic powder, and
    nutmeg. Massage the mix into the brisket.

  4. Place the brisket on top of the veggies then top it with the apricots. Get a mixing bowl:
    mix in it the wine, broth and honey.

  5. Drizzle the mix all over the brisket. Put on the lid and cook it for 7 h on low or 4 h on
    high. Serve it warm.

  6. Enjoy.
